> No, generically it isn't. iPod (and iPhone, and I suspect other stuff from 
> Apple) does not allow its filesystem to be visible via USB transparently. One 
> has to use iTunes or gtkpod or some other program in order to communicate 
> with 
> the iPod.

You can access the files on an iPod as a USB drive. I do so on my system
(F17, Gnome, iPod 160GB) without an issue.
